Alisin ang ASCII Character # 127 sa Excel

Ang bawat karakter sa isang computer - maaaring i-print at hindi ma-print - ay may isang numero na kilala bilang Unicode character code o halaga nito.

Ang isa pang, mas matanda, at mas mahusay na kilalang character set ay ASCII , na nakatayo para sa American Standard Code para sa Information Interchange , ay isinama sa Unicode set. Bilang resulta, ang unang 128 character (0 hanggang 127) ng hanay ng Unicode ay kapareho ng ASCII set.

Marami sa mga unang 128 Unicode character ang tinutukoy bilang mga character ng kontrol at ginagamit ito ng mga program sa computer upang kontrolin ang mga aparatong paligid tulad ng mga printer.

Dahil dito, hindi ito nilalayon para gamitin sa mga worksheet ng Excel at maaaring maging sanhi ng iba't ibang mga error kung mayroon. Ang CLEAN function ng Excel ay mag-aalis ng karamihan sa mga hindi naka-print na character na ito - maliban sa character na # 127.

01 ng 03

Unicode Character # 127

Alisin ang ASCII Character # 127 mula sa Data sa Excel. © Ted French

Kinokontrol ng character na Unicode # 127 ang delete key sa keyboard. Bilang tulad, ito ay hindi inilaan upang kailanman ay naroroon sa isang Excel worksheet.

Kung kasalukuyan, ipinapakita ito bilang isang makitid na hugis na hugis ng kahon - tulad ng ipinapakita sa cell A2 sa imahe sa itaas - at marahil ito ay na-import o kinopya nang hindi sinasadya kasama ang ilang mahusay na data .

Ang presensya nito ay maaaring:

02 ng 03

Pag-alis ng Unicode Character # 127

Kahit na ang character na ito ay hindi maaaring alisin sa function na MALIBAN, maaari itong alisin gamit ang isang formula na naglalaman ng mga function ng SUBSTITUTE at CHAR .

Ang halimbawa sa larawan sa itaas ay nagpapakita ng apat na hugis na hugis-parihaba kasama ang numero 10 sa cell A2 ng isang worksheet ng Excel.

Ang LEN function - na kung saan ang bilang ng mga character sa isang cell - sa cell E2 ay nagpapakita na ang cell A2 ay naglalaman ng anim na character - ang dalawang digit para sa numero 10 at ang apat na mga kahon para sa character na # 127.

Dahil sa pagkakaroon ng character # 127 sa cell A2, ang dagdag na formula sa cell D2 ay nagbabalik ng #VALUE! maling mensahe.

Ang Cell A3 ay naglalaman ng formula ng SUBSTITUTE / CHAR

= SUBSTITUTE (A2, CHAR (127), "")

upang palitan ang apat na # 127 na mga character mula sa cell A2 na walang - (ipinapakita ng mga walang laman na marka ng panipi sa dulo ng formula).

Ang resulta

  1. ang bilang ng character sa cell E3 ay nabawasan sa dalawa - para sa dalawang digit sa numero 10;
  2. ang dagdag na formula sa cell D3 ay nagbabalik sa tamang sagot ng 15 kapag nagdadagdag ng mga nilalaman para sa cell A3 + B3 (10 + 5).

Ang function na SUBSTITUTE ay ang aktwal na pagpapalit habang ang CHAR function ay ginagamit upang sabihin sa formula kung anong karakter ang papalit.

03 ng 03

Pag-alis ng Mga Non-Breaking Space mula sa isang Worksheet

Katulad sa mga di-maipi-print na mga character ay ang di-paglabag na espasyo (& nbsp) na maaari ring maging sanhi ng mga problema sa mga kalkulasyon at pag-format sa isang worksheet. Ang numero ng Unicode code para sa mga walang breaking na puwang ay # 160.

Ang mga puwang ng hindi pagsira ay ginagamit nang malawakan sa mga web page, kaya kung ang data ay nakopya sa Excel mula sa isang web page, maaaring hindi lumabas sa isang worksheet ang mga di-paglabag na mga puwang.

Ang pag-aalis ng mga puwang na hindi pagsira ay maaaring gawin gamit ang isang formula na pinagsasama ang mga function na SUBSTITUTE, CHAR, at TRIM.